March 31 is International Transgender Day of Visibility, a day dedicated to celebrating the lives and accomplishments of transgender and gender-nonconforming people, while continuing to bring attention to the ongoing prejudice and violence the community faces every day. It’s also a day that serves as an important reminder to cisgender folks...

Table of Contents
The Eastern Algonkian Wabanaki Confederacy / by Frank G. Speck -- Wabanaki Wampum protocol / by Willard Walker -- Wapapi akonutomakonol / by Lewis Mitchell -- Wampum records annotated.
